Understanding Prozac: A Powerful Antidepressant

Prozac, known generically as fluoxetine, is one of the most widely prescribed antidepressants worldwide. It belongs to a class of drugs called selective serotonin reuptake inhibitors (SSRIs). These medications work by increasing the level of serotonin in the brain, a neurotransmitter that influences mood, emotion, and sleep. By preventing the reabsorption (reuptake) of serotonin into neurons, Prozac helps maintain higher serotonin levels in the synaptic gap, which can improve mood and reduce symptoms of depression.

Introduced in the late 1980s, Prozac quickly became a revolutionary treatment option because it was more tolerable than older antidepressants like tricyclics or monoamine oxidase inhibitors (MAOIs). Its ease of use and relatively mild side effect profile made it a popular choice among doctors and patients alike. Today, it’s prescribed not only for depression but also for several other mental health conditions.

How Does Prozac Work in the Brain?

The human brain relies on neurotransmitters to send signals between nerve cells. Serotonin is one such chemical that stabilizes mood and feelings of well-being. When someone experiences depression or anxiety, serotonin levels often drop or become imbalanced.

Prozac blocks the serotonin transporter responsible for pulling serotonin back into the neuron after it has transmitted its signal. By blocking this transporter, Prozac allows serotonin to remain active longer in the synapse. This increased availability helps improve communication between nerve cells and positively affects mood regulation.

It’s important to note that while Prozac changes brain chemistry quickly after ingestion, its full therapeutic effects usually take several weeks to appear. This delay happens because downstream changes in receptor sensitivity and neural pathways need time to adjust.

The Role of Serotonin in Mental Health

Serotonin impacts many bodily functions beyond mood—such as appetite, sleep cycles, memory, and even digestion. Low serotonin activity has been linked with depression symptoms like sadness, fatigue, irritability, and loss of interest in activities.

By boosting serotonin levels through reuptake inhibition, Prozac helps restore balance in these systems. This makes it effective not only for major depressive disorder but also for anxiety disorders where serotonin dysregulation plays a role.

Medical Conditions Treated with Prozac

Prozac’s uses extend beyond just treating depression. Here’s a list of some common conditions for which doctors prescribe this medication:

    • Major Depressive Disorder (MDD): The primary condition treated by Prozac; characterized by persistent sadness and loss of interest.
    • Obsessive-Compulsive Disorder (OCD): Helps reduce compulsions and obsessive thoughts by balancing neurotransmitters.
    • Panic Disorder: Reduces frequency and severity of panic attacks.
    • Bipolar Depression: Sometimes used alongside mood stabilizers to treat depressive episodes.
    • Bulimia Nervosa: Can decrease binge-eating behaviors.
    • Anxiety Disorders: Helps manage generalized anxiety symptoms.

Its versatility makes it a valuable tool in psychiatric medicine. However, treatment plans always depend on individual patient needs and medical history.

Dosing and Administration Details

Prozac usually comes in capsules or liquid form. The typical starting dose for adults with depression is 20 mg once daily. Depending on response and tolerance, doctors may adjust this dose up to 80 mg per day.

The medication is often taken in the morning because it can cause insomnia or restlessness if taken later in the day. Patients are advised to take it consistently at the same time daily to maintain steady blood levels.

Stopping Prozac abruptly isn’t recommended due to potential withdrawal symptoms like dizziness or irritability; instead, doses should be tapered gradually under medical supervision.

Potential Side Effects of Prozac

Like all medications, Prozac comes with possible side effects—some common and others less frequent but more serious.

Common side effects include:

    • Nausea or upset stomach
    • Dizziness or headache
    • Sleeplessness or fatigue
    • Dry mouth
    • Sweating
    • Anxiety or nervousness (especially initially)

Most people find these side effects mild and temporary as their bodies adjust to the medication.

More serious but rare side effects include:

    • Increased risk of suicidal thoughts (especially in young adults under 25)
    • Serotonin syndrome—a dangerous buildup of serotonin causing confusion, rapid heartbeat, fever
    • Severe allergic reactions like rash or swelling

If any severe symptoms occur after starting Prozac, immediate medical attention is crucial.

The Importance of Medical Supervision During Treatment

Regular follow-ups with a healthcare provider ensure that any side effects are caught early. Doctors monitor progress closely during the first few months when risks are higher.

Patients should never adjust doses without consulting their doctor—even if they feel better—because stopping suddenly can cause withdrawal symptoms or relapse.

The Impact of Prozac on Daily Life and Mental Wellness

For many people struggling with depression or anxiety disorders, taking Prozac can be life-changing. Restoring chemical balance often leads to improved energy levels, better sleep patterns, enhanced concentration, and reduced emotional distress.

However, medication alone isn’t always enough. Combining Prozac with therapy sessions such as cognitive behavioral therapy (CBT) tends to produce better outcomes than either treatment alone.

Some users report feeling “numb” emotionally at first or experience sexual side effects that affect quality of life. Open communication with healthcare providers helps address these issues through dose adjustments or alternative treatments if needed.

Misperceptions About Antidepressants Like Prozac

There’s still stigma surrounding antidepressants despite their proven benefits. Some believe they create dependence or change personality permanently—that’s not accurate when used properly under supervision.

Prozac doesn’t cause addiction like narcotics do but does require careful management due to withdrawal risks if stopped suddenly. It supports brain chemistry rather than “masking” problems temporarily.

Understanding what this medication does—and doesn’t do—helps patients make informed decisions about their mental health care without fear or misunderstanding.

The Science Behind What Is Prozac and What Does It Do?

Research studies have extensively examined fluoxetine’s effectiveness since its debut over three decades ago. Clinical trials show significant improvement in depressive symptoms compared with placebo groups across diverse populations.

Neuroimaging studies reveal changes in brain activity patterns after chronic SSRI use—particularly increased activation in areas related to mood regulation such as the prefrontal cortex and hippocampus.

Scientists continue exploring how SSRIs affect neuroplasticity—the brain’s ability to form new connections—which might explain lasting benefits beyond simple chemical balancing.

A Closer Look at Fluoxetine’s Pharmacokinetics

Fluoxetine is absorbed well orally with peak blood concentrations reached within six hours after ingestion. Its long half-life (about two to four days) means it stays active longer than many other SSRIs—this allows once-daily dosing but also means discontinuation requires slow tapering over weeks rather than days.

The drug undergoes liver metabolism primarily via CYP450 enzymes into an active metabolite called norfluoxetine that contributes to its therapeutic effects over time.
